Product Description
Something is wrong with Claire, but she doesn’t know what. Nobody does, not even her doctors. All she wants is to return to her happy and athletic teenage self. But her accumulating symptoms-chronic fatigue, pounding headaches, weight gain-hint that there’s something not right inside Claire’s body.
Claire’s high school experience becomes filled with MRIs, visits to the Mayo Clinic and multiple surgeries to remove a brain tumour. But even in her most difficult moments battling chronic illness, Claire manages to find solace in her family, her closest friends and her art.
A deeply personal and visually arresting memoir that draws on the author’s high school diaries and drawings, One in a Million is also a sophisticated portrayal of pain, depression and fear that any teen or adult can relate to.
